  • Assay Detection Range
    6.25-400ng/mL
  • Assay Precision
    Intra-assay Precision (Precision within an assay): 3 samples with low, middle and high level Gremlin 1 (GREM1) were tested 20 times on one plate, respectively. Inter-assay Precision (Precision between assays): 3 samples with low, middle and high ...
  • Assay Sensitivity
    The minimum detectable dose of this kit is typically less than 2.35ng/mL
  • Assay Test Principle
    The test principle applied in this kit is Sandwich enzyme immunoassay. The microtiter plate provided in this kit has been pre-coated with an antibody specific to Gremlin 1 (GREM1). Standards or samples are then added to the appropriate microtiter ...
  • Assay Time
    3h
